George Russell says Mercedes will ‘go for victory’ after taking pole in Canada

George Russell claimed only his second career pole (Ryan Remiorz/The Canadian Press via AP)

George Russell immediately set his sights on victory after taking only his second career pole position during a scintillating Canadian Grand Prix qualifying.

Russell set an identical time to Red Bull’s three-time world champion Max Verstappen amid changeable weather on Montreal’s Ile Notre-Dame but will line up first by virtue of having set his lap time earlier.
